SHIFTER CABLE BUSHING, if this doesn't work for you look that up. It's if the shifter cable is loose, the bushing has fallen off. Bushing is a clip that goes onto the cable wire and then clips into it's secured location. If that cable is loose it won't shift gears. Took. About 10 mins for me to do. Part costed about 20 or less

Our 2013 Chrysler 200 was stuck in park. Turned out to be a bad brake light switch. Bought a new switch and replaced the original switch. $16 for an OEM switch and we’re good to go. Not a difficult job, but it was a PITA working on my back.
My 2010 Sebring stuck in P, but driving forward! I've towed it but, am I understanding that it may be a brake system issue? Also, my cruise went out 6 months ago.
@@daiquiririchard8823 I would check the shift cable. Has it detached or some how gone out of alignment at the transmission? When you are really in park, the transmission stops the car from moving, not the brakes. I would guess the transmission is in another gear other than park.
